Chemical Works of Gedeon Richter  (OTCPK:RGEDF) Net-Net Working Capital Explanation

One research study, covering the years 1970 through 1983 showed that portfolios picked at the beginning of each year, and held for one year, returned 29.4 percent, on average, over the 13-year period, compared to 11.5 percent for the S&P 500 Index. Other studies of Graham's strategy produced similar results.

Benjamin Graham looked for companies whose market values were less than two-thirds of their net-net value. They are collected under our Net-Net screener.

Chemical Works of Gedeon Richter Net-Net Working Capital Calculation

Chemical Works of Gedeon Richter's Net-Net Working Capital (NNWC) per share for the fiscal year that ended in Dec. 2025 is calculated as

Net-Net Working Capital(A: Dec. 2025 )
=(Cash, Cash Equivalents, Marketable Securities+0.75 * Accounts Receivable+0.5 * Total Inventories-Total Liabilities
-Preferred Stock-Minority Interest)/Shares Outstanding (EOP)
=(808.895+0.75 * 765.759+0.5 * 670.88-931.623
-0-7.818)/182.388
=4.27

In calculating the Net-Net Working Capital (NNWC), Benjamin Graham assumed that a company's accounts receivable is only worth 75% its value, its inventory is only worth 50% of its value, but its liabilities have to be paid in full.

In addition, Graham believed that preferred stock belongs on the liability side of the balance sheet, not as part of capital and surplus. In "Security Analysis", preferred stock is dubbed "an imperfect creditorship position" that is best placed on the balance sheet alongside funded debt.

This is a conservative way of estimating the company's value.

Chemical Works of Gedeon Richter Business Description

Address Gyomroi ut 19-21, Budapest, HUN, 1103
Chemical Works of Gedeon Richter PLC is a pharmaceutical company. The company focuses on the development and manufacture of gynaecological, cardiovascular, and central nervous system products. It manufactures medicines including original, generic and licensed products for treatment in the therapeutic area. The group is active in two business segments namely, the Pharma segment comprising Women's Healthcare, Neuropsychiatry, Biotechnology, General Medicine, and Other pharma; and the Others segment includes the remaining wholesale and retail business of the Group and all other activities. The company operates internationally.
